Naxotek: A Modern Sans Serif for Web Design

As a web designer, I’m always on the lookout for fonts that bring both personality and clarity to a site. Naxotek is one of those rare finds—a sans serif typeface that feels modern, clean, and versatile enough for a wide range of digital projects.

First Impressions on a Landing Page

Testing Naxotek on a product landing page was like discovering a new tool in my design toolkit. The font’s balanced strokes and subtle curves give it a polished look without being too rigid. I used it for the hero section headline, and it immediately added a sense of sophistication. The font’s weight options made it easy to create visual hierarchy, from bold headers to lighter subheadings.

One thing I noticed right away was how well Naxotek works with different background colors. On a dark background, it stands out clearly, while on a light backdrop, it maintains its elegance without feeling washed out. It’s perfect for websites that want to feel professional yet approachable.

Responsive Design and Mobile Usability

When I tested Naxotek on mobile devices, it performed consistently across screen sizes. The font’s legibility at smaller sizes made it ideal for buttons, call-to-action elements, and navigation menus. I paired it with a simpler sans serif for body text, and the contrast helped guide users’ eyes naturally through the content.

I also experimented with using Naxotek over image banners. Its clean lines allowed it to pop against complex backgrounds without overwhelming the design. This makes it a great choice for sites that rely heavily on imagery, like creative portfolios or online stores with high-quality product shots.

Brand Identity and Visual Consistency

For a boutique online store, I used Naxotek as the primary font for headings and logos. Its modern aesthetic aligned perfectly with the brand’s aesthetic, giving the site a cohesive and professional look. The nine italics offered flexibility for accents and decorative elements, which helped add visual interest without complicating the design.

The font’s matching thicknesses ensured that all elements—headers, buttons, and even small labels—felt part of the same family. This consistency is crucial for building brand recognition and trust, especially in an online environment where first impressions matter.

Font Pairing and Design Flexibility

Naxotek pairs well with a variety of other fonts, making it a flexible choice for different design needs. For a more editorial feel, I combined it with a simple serif font for body text. The contrast between the two created a balanced and readable layout, ideal for blogs or content-heavy sites.

On the other hand, pairing it with a bold display font worked well for promotional sections or campaign pages. The combination gave the design energy and focus, making key messages stand out without sacrificing readability.

Considerations for Web Use

While Naxotek excels in headings and display use, it’s not the best choice for long paragraphs of text. The font’s decorative elements can make dense blocks of copy harder to read, especially on smaller screens. For body text, a cleaner sans serif or serif font would be more suitable.

It’s also important to check the font’s webfont availability and licensing before using it on client projects or commercial websites. Naxotek offers multiple weights and styles, which makes it easier to implement across different parts of a site without overloading the load time.

Overall, Naxotek is a strong addition to any web designer’s font collection. Its modern look, versatility, and ease of use make it a go-to choice for headers, logos, and other prominent design elements. Whether you’re working on a portfolio site, an online store, or a marketing campaign, Naxotek brings both style and functionality to your digital projects.
